🇬🇧 Occasional meaning: English Vocabulary Flash Card

adjective
If something is occasional, it only happens once in a while, not every day or on a set schedule. It might surprise you when it happens, because it doesn’t follow a regular pattern. For example, an occasional trip to the park means you go there sometimes, but not every weekend or every Friday.
